Last Updated: Sep 27, 2025 (UTC)Excel Realty Plans ₹2,500 Cr Fundraising, Shares Surge
Detailed Analysis
- On September 23-24, 2025, Excel Realty N Infra’s Board announced plans to significantly increase its fundraising limit from ₹500 crore to ₹2,500 crore and its authorized share capital from ₹500 crore to ₹2,500 crore, potentially through preferential allotments, warrants, FCCBs, or QIPs. This move suggests the company anticipates needing substantial capital for future growth or strategic initiatives.
- Following this announcement on September 24, 2025, Excel Realty’s shares jumped 1.99%, closing at ₹1.54 on the NSE and hitting the upper circuit, with trading volume reaching approximately 1 crore shares – exceeding the one-month average of 54 lakh shares. This surge indicates strong investor enthusiasm, despite ongoing financial challenges.
- Despite reporting a substantial 85.0% year-over-year decrease in net profit to ₹0 Crores as of September 4, 2025, the stock has seen impressive gains over various periods: 16% in the last month, 79% in three months, 90% in six months, and a remarkable 2,100% over five years. This disconnect between profitability and stock performance suggests speculative trading and investor optimism about future potential.
- Earlier in the month, on September 11, 2025, Excel Realty held an Extra-Ordinary General Meeting (EGM) where shareholders approved increasing the company’s authorized capital, a move that now seems even more prescient given the subsequent fundraising announcement. This proactive step demonstrates the company’s foresight in preparing for future financial needs.
- As of September 22, 2025, Excel Realty’s share price closed at ₹1.60 on the BSE and ₹1.55 on the NSE, with a market capitalization of approximately ₹225.71 crore. However, the stock experienced a four-day consecutive decline of 6.98% culminating in a 1.84% drop on September 22, 2025, potentially signaling profit-taking after recent gains.
- To ensure regulatory compliance, Excel Realty N Infra announced a trading window closure for directors and specified persons, effective October 1, 2025, until 48 hours after the financial results for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, are declared. This is a standard practice to prevent insider trading.
- Despite a low return on equity of -1.10% over the last three years and a lengthy debtor collection period of 758 days, Excel Realty N Infra is actively working to reduce its debt and approaching a debt-free status as of September 11, 2025. This debt reduction is a positive step, but the slow collection of receivables remains a concern.
The Investment Story: September was a month of significant developments for Excel Realty, marked by a bold fundraising plan and a corresponding surge in investor interest, despite underlying financial difficulties. The company is actively working to improve its financial position, but profitability remains a key challenge.
What It Means for Investors: The proposed fundraising and capital increase present both opportunities and risks. While the capital infusion could fuel growth, investors should carefully consider the potential dilution and the company’s ability to generate sustainable profits. The stock’s recent volatility highlights its speculative nature.
Looking Ahead: Investors should closely monitor the details of the fundraising plan, including the terms and intended use of proceeds. Tracking the company’s progress in improving profitability and reducing its debtor collection period will also be crucial in the coming quarters.
The Bottom Line: Excel Realty remains a high-risk, high-reward investment. The company’s proactive steps to address its financial challenges are encouraging, but significant uncertainties remain, and thorough due diligence is essential.
